Genetic Carriers
Pathogens have adapted to efficiently deliver genetic material into target cells, rendering them a powerful mechanism for genetic modification. Common biological delivery agents feature:
Adenoviral vectors – Capable of infecting both mitotic and quiescent cells but may provoke immune responses.
AAV vectors – Favorable due to their minimal antigenicity and capacity for maintaining long-term genetic activity.
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Embed within the host genome, providing stable gene expression, with HIV-derived carriers being particularly beneficial for altering dormant cellular structures.
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ods
Non-viral delivery methods present a less immunogenic choice, minimizing host rejection. These include:
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Encapsulating genetic sequences for efficient intracellular transport.
Electrical Permeabilization – Applying electric shocks to create temporary pores in plasma barriers, permitting nucleic acid infiltration.
Direct Injection – Introducing genetic material directly into localized cells.

Genetic Engineering Solutions: Restructuring the Genetic Blueprint
Gene therapy achieves results by altering the fundamental issue of chromosomal abnormalities:
Direct Genetic Therapy: Introduces genetic instructions straight into the patient’s body, for example the regulatory-approved Luxturna for managing genetic vision loss.
External Genetic Modification: Involves reprogramming a biological samples externally and then returning them, as seen in some emerging solutions for red blood cell disorders and compromised immunity.
The advent of gene-editing CRISPR has rapidly progressed gene therapy research, enabling high-precision adjustments at the molecular structure.
